
Skyrim 1.4 Update: Lag Fixes Work, But Bugs Remain - PS3 Gamers
Tom Hopkins
Crucial Skyrim PS3 patch kills lag, but game still suffers from freezing and low frame-rates say gamers.
Published on Feb 13, 2012
Skyrim's worst problems are behind it on the PS3 according to gamers that have installed the long-awaited 1.4 patch - but the game still suffers from freezing and poor framerates according to posters on the Bethesda forums.
"After all the wait skyrim ps3 is still inferior. The fps is a bit better though but frames still drop in certain areas," writes one user.
"The game's framerate IS subpar. It's nice that the lag seems to be clearing up, but it dances around between 15 and 30 fps," comments another user, while other comments include: "FREEZING is not gone!"
Skyrim players were advised to create a new manual save to get the best out of the new update.
Bethesda also launched the Skyrim Creation Kit for PC last week.
